About Brussels
Brussels serves as the administrative center of Belgium.
Brussels is the biggest metropolitan area in Belgium.
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 73%. Winters bring an average temperature of 3 °C, with humidity levels of about 81%.
Brussels is home of the academic institute Université libre de Bruxelles. The biggest sports facility in Brussels is King Baudouin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Saint-Luc University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Sonian Forest,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Royal Museums of Fine Arts of Belgium, which showcases Brussels’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Royal Library of Belgium for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Brussels Airport by Train,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Brussels with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Metro, Tram and Bus.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Brussels-Central, Brussels-North and Brussels-South.
In Brussels,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: MOBIB card, Cash and Credit Card.
About Jerez de la Frontera
Summers have an average temperature of 33 °C, with humidity levels of about 55%. Winters bring an average temperature of 11 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%.
Jerez de la Frontera is home of the academic institute University of Cádiz. The biggest sports facility in Jerez de la Frontera is Estadio Municipal de Chapín,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Hospital de Jerez.
Nature lovers can unwind at Parque González Hontoria,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Museo Arqueológico, which showcases Jerez de la Frontera’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Biblioteca Municipal Central for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Jerez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Jerez de la Frontera with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Central Bus Station and Jerez Railway Station.
In Jerez de la Frontera,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ash and Credit Card.
